Three days in a row is too much!
Saturday we installed the new panel.
Clear, easy to read and now we have good info from the 3 meters at the bottom.
Sunday we decommissioned the temporary garbage can filter.
We installed the replacement waterfall bilge pump and moved the small waterfall pump so it doesn’t have to pump water 20 feet away.
Then we installed the 2nd pump and Y connection to the filter.
Monday we had a lesson in hydraulics and learned (for boring reasons you don’t care about) that our two pump solution to the filter would never work, so we took the Y piping and the 2nd pump out.
Also the small pump feeding the waterfall isn’t enough by itself so that’s out as well.
So basically we scrapped what we installed on sunday and are now heading in a slightly new direction:
Big, yellow Marinebaby pump on the filter all the time.
Bilge pump on the waterfall all the time.
The small pump and what would have been the 2nd filter pump will become aerator/bubblers - we need more aeration.
They will only run in the high sun so we still get to do that part of the project.
